This isn't a real bug. Problem: You inserted an entry for an index and a comment at the same position. What should appear? Both are nonprinting fields that must not consume any space. So the grey field for the index entry is overlayed by the colourless "field" for the comment. Try the following: 1. place the cursor in the empty paragraph before 2. press key cursor right → the cursor stands in the comment (line changed) 3. press key cursor right → the cursor stands between the comment (line changed) and the index entry 4. press key cursor right → the cursor stands behind the index entry but it is not visible 5. press key cursor right → the cursor stands after the first character You can change it: 1. delete the comment 2. select the grey index entry 3. insert a comment. Now the index entry stays visible.
